This is an action in which plaintiff in error, plaintiff below, sought to restrain defendant, City of Colorado Springs, from enforcing judgments obtained against him by the city for infractions of municipal ordinances. A motion for dismissal interposed by the city was sustained, and appropriate orders were entered by the trial court.

Error to the District Court of El Paso County, Hon. G. Russell Miller, Judge.

Mr. GEORGE M. GIBSON, for plaintiff in error.

Mr. BEN S. WENDELKEN, for defendant in error.


Judgment affirmed en banc without written opinion.
